Reproduction
Steps to reproduce:
- Go to https://material.angular.dev/components/chips/examples
- Open NVDA screen reader in browse mode
- Start navigating in browse mode with a help of up/down arrows
- Navigate with the help of arrows to chips select list
Expected Behavior
NVDA is reading information about the select list and keeps navigating in the browse mode
Actual Behavior
NVDA automatically switches to the focus mode and prevents user from further page exploring in the browse mode.
Environment
- Angular: 20.2
- CDK/Material: Material components
- Browser(s): Chrome
- Operating System (e.g. Windows, macOS, Ubuntu): Windows
- NVDA 2025.3
